In physics, particularly in wave mechanics and simple harmonic motion, the relationship between linear frequency and angular frequency is fundamental:
- Frequency (f): Represents the number of cycles or revolutions completed per unit time, measured in Hertz (Hz) or s⁻¹.
- Angular Frequency (ω): Represents the rate of change of the angular displacement, measured in radians per second (rad/s).
Since one complete cycle corresponds to a rotation of 2π radians, the angular frequency is calculated by multiplying the linear frequency by 2π. Thus, the formula is ω = 2πf.
